Glazier's points are used to hold the glass in place

Glazier's points are required when installing a new window to the home. These are small metal bars that help hold the glass in place. These bars can be used in wooden or vinyl frame windows.

It is recommended to put eight glazier points on each side. This will give enough space for the glass to fit without jamming. You may need to add more points when you have windows with bigger sizes. You can either make use of a putty knife, or a rubber mallet to push the points into the wood.

Before you begin, make sure that the wood has been sanded and free of any debris. To do this you need to scrape the edges of the rabbet using the sanding tool or paintbrush.

After the wood is sanded, you can remove any old glazing compounds. Homeowners can also use a heat gun to soften the old compound.

Once the old compound is removed after which you can apply a fresh glaze. To do this, you'll require an oil-based putty. You should leave 1/16 inches of space between each side of the window.

Once you have applied the glaze, you should let it cure for at least a week before painting. You should also wear eye protection and heavy gloves.

It is possible to remove the glazier's sharp points with the putty knife and pliers. To loosen the point you can also try wriggling it.

You'll also have to apply a layer of linseed oils onto the wood. Linseed oil prevents the wood from absorbing the oil from the glazing compound. It also prevents the putty drying too quickly.

When the glazing is finished then you can place the glass replacement glass in windows in the frame. To push the glass into the frame you can make use of spring clips, screwdrivers or a putty blade.

If you have a metallic frame the glass is usually held in place using spring clips made from metal. The majority of hardware stores can cut glass for you.

Cost to replace broken glass

The cost of replacing broken glass in windows is dependent on several factors such as the size, design, and the type of window. Single-pane windows are usually the most affordable replacements.

Double-pane windows cost more to replace. A contractor will be more costly to hire to complete the job.

It may be possible to do the job yourself, based on the design of your windows. In this case you'll be able cut the glass to size and secure it with caulking that is light. The glass can be then painted or covered with trim.

If you decide to do it on your own, expect to pay between $35 to $85, which does not include the cost of the glass. If you decide to engage an expert glazier, be willing to pay a $100 to $150 call-out charge. The majority of glaziers will offer free estimates.

If you're in search of a glazier, be sure to ask about their reputation. Also, you should get at least three quotes. Some companies offer discounts up to 10%. You can also search online for reputable companies.

Prices may vary based on the type of glass and the degree of difficulty of the repair. The average national cost is $186. A double pane will increase the price to $200 or more. Specialty labor costs can vary from $325 to $500. Depending on the type of window, the cost of replacing a single pane could be as low as $50.

Another option is to use an emergency make-safe. This is a good option if your window breaks in the night. You can protect the opening by using an emergency make-safe until the glass is put in place. Typically the option to cover this is available through your insurance policy.

Depending on the glass the glass is made of, the cost of replacement glass units may be high. Glass with a single pane is the cheapest to replace, but it's less efficient in energy than double pane.

Double-pane glass improves soundproofing. It also improves energy efficiency. As such, it's worth the cost. The upgrade of single-pane windows will help you save 10% to 30 percent on your energy bills.
